Details

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: ALSA: memalloc: prefer dmamappingerror() over explicit address checking With CONFIGDMAAPIDEBUG enabled, the following warning is observed: DMA-API: sndhdaintel 0000:03:00.1: device driver failed to check map error[device address=0x00000000ffff0000] [size=20480 bytes] [mapped as single] WARNING: CPU: 28 PID: 2255 at kernel/dma/debug.c:1036 checkunmap+0x1408/0x2430 CPU: 28 UID: 42 PID: 2255 Comm: wireplumber Tainted: G W L 6.12.0-10-133577cad6bf48e5a7848c4338124081393bfe8a+ #759 debugdmaunmappage+0xe9/0xf0 snddmawcfree+0x85/0x130 [sndpcm] sndpcmlibfreepages+0x1e3/0x440 [sndpcm] sndpcmcommonioctl+0x1c9a/0x2960 [sndpcm] sndpcmioctl+0x6a/0xc0 [sndpcm] ... Check for returned DMA addresses using specialized dmamapping_error() helper which is generally recommended for this purpose by Documentation/core-api/dma-api.rst.
